Importance of On-Demand Trucking and Shipping in Freight

Like all other industries, the transportation market is also updating its machinery to state-of-the-art, new technology that matches the demands of today’s fast-paced secondary sector. Because of the vigorous outbound sales strategies to accquire and expand the customer base, the business world has progressed to a stage in product supply where one-day delivery and detailed order tracking has become essential. It is the topmost priority for ordered supplies to reach their destinations as soon as possible. 

On-demand trucking involves relying on the leftover capacity in ‘on-demand’ shipments, instead of shipments pre-established contracts. This acts as a win-win for both parties, as it allows the carrier to eliminate empty miles while the shippers get to choose the truck of their choice, especially when supply exceeds regular lanes. 

Reasons On-Demand Trucking Is Gaining Popularity 

Ever since the global pandemic caused major disruptions in the supply chain, shipping products to customers has become a big challenge. With consumers stocking up on everyday miscellaneous items, and businesses struggling to bridge the supply and demand deficit, the only way out is on-demand trucking.  

Electronic Logging Device (ELD) 

These are federally mandated devices that keep close track of and surveil drivers’ activities, in order to ensure that they obey trucking guidelines and the hourly service (HOS) law.  

Market Volatility 

Trucking availability is very limited these days. There has been a shortage of trucks and drivers over the past few years. On the other hand, freight demand has also steadily increased alongside the demand for drivers and trucks. 

New Trucking Apps 

There are quite a few new trucking apps that have sprung up and are occupying the market. For example, the Uber Freight app is a reliable one, and its user interface is very similar to its ride-sharing service app. Similarly, Amazon has also started its on-demand trucking app. 

Rising Interest Rates 

The increasing interest rates equate to a higher overall cost of transporting goods, which is why shippers choose to avail the on-demand options that are most suitable for their needs. 

Increase Contract Rates 

Because trucking capacity and supply are tight, the rates have continued to rise. In response to this, shippers have been forced to rely on intermodal transport or rail to move their cargo. 

Significance of On-Demand Trucking

Given the current supply chain constraints of today, on-demand trucking is becoming the best way to get your supplies to their destination. This is why on-demand trucking is important: 

Data Analytics Features 

Data collected by on-demand trucking tools allow you to make more informed decisions using real-time analytics. This gives direct and almost instant access to detailed reports, created through diagnostic, predictive, and prescriptive analysis. Moreover, this also eliminates the need for tedious manual calculations. 

Tracking Each Move 

The most recent updates in on-demand trucking technology allow customers and suppliers to track the delivery status of their supplies in real time. This allows them to optimize delivery routes and tailor the delivery schedule to their needs, using a Courier app, for an enhanced customer experience for customer appreciation day

Managing Orders Efficiently 

On-demand trucking services have helped equip users with platforms that have intuitive built in interfaces that can easily manage and schedule deliveries. They can also track and monitor parcel activities from a single dashboard. This helps minimize the number of courier thefts and misplaced packages. 

Optimizing Route Planning 

Your delivery team can improve and optimize their performance with the route planning features in logistics applications. This helps suppliers select delivery options that have the shortest and fastest route, saving fuel costs and time alike. 

The Advantages 

There is a lot of potential for development in the freight and transportation management industry, thanks to the advent of on-demand trucking service applications. Here are a few advantages they bring to the table: 

Cost Effectiveness 

Relying on a trucking app or courier business improves ROI drastically because automation helps optimize resources in a way that reduces third-party involvement. A greater number of deliveries can be made in less time this way, improving business overall.  

Convenience 

On-demand trucking is dynamic in nature and allows direct and real-time management through applications. Customers can easily track and schedule orders, without the stress of wondering when they’ll arrive. Additionally, coordination with delivery agents, too, is an option if you want an update on your parcel, reducing miscommunication and call center burden. 

Better Supply Chain Management 

The constant tracking option makes room for convenient and effective communication between backend teams and truck drivers. This helps smooth out supply chain operations as real-time communication helps avoid blockages or hindrances along the way. 

Convenient Warehouse Management 

On-demand delivery options facilitate warehouse management because stocking up your inventory becomes much easier. This helps keep track of the stock and demand, whilst reducing overhead costs and extra waste.
